Output 660d2b1684b29f4cdaf37e73c2e2bb9b5d634da5aa6945bc840e2a04f83f76ea:2

value
19325285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c341d51402d634bc19f9f8c2b0d198bcaa7d77db OP_EQUAL
address
MRharwwWm5K4B8dUaHKubUbdH72cnL51N4
transaction
660d2b1684b29f4cdaf37e73c2e2bb9b5d634da5aa6945bc840e2a04f83f76ea
spent
true